Mexican Phyllo Cups Recipe

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
45 pre-baked mini phyllo cup shells (found in freezer) 1-2c bag of Mexican cheese 1 diced tomato 1/4c chopped green pepper 1c chopped red pepper 2/3c black beans (drained) 4 T hot salsa 1/4tsp chili powder

Directions:
Directions:
Mix tomato, green & red peppers, black beans, salsa and chili powder in a bowl. Toss lightly so you don't break the beans. Add mixture to each of the cups and top with cheese. Bake on cookie sheet for 5 minutes or until the cheese is melted.

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
45
Preparation Time:
Preparation Time:
20 minutes
